Key Roles and Potential Benefits of MOTS-c

Research into MOTS-c is ongoing, but early studies highlight several key areas where this peptide demonstrates significant influence:

* Metabolic Regulation: MOTS-c is a crucial regulator of energy metabolism作者:H Kumagai·2024·被引用次数:7—MOTS-c directly binds to CK2and regulates its activity in a tissue-specific manner. MOTS-c modulates glucose metabolism and muscle mass by activating CK2.. It influences the balance of amino acids, carbohydrates, and lipids, helping to maintain metabolic homeostasis. This peptide has been shown to reduce insulin resistance and decrease obesity, making it a potential therapeutic target for conditions like type 2 diabetes and metabolic syndrome.MOTS-c (human) is a blood-brain barrier-penetrating, mitochondrial-derived peptide that modulates the AMPK/PGC-1α pathway to enhance insulin sensitivity.

* Exercise Mimetic Effects: Intriguingly, MOTS-c acts as an "exercise mimetic." Studies in mice have shown that MOTS-c treatment can improve physical performance across different age groups, mimicking some of the beneficial effects of exercise. It helps regulate skeletal muscle metabolism and can mitigate age-related declines in physical function.

* Anti-Aging Properties: Given its role in metabolic health and physical performance, MOTS-c is being investigated for its anti-aging potentialMOTS-c modulates skeletal muscle function by directly .... It has been observed to alleviate aging-related metabolic disorders, including cardiovascular impairments and reduced exercise capacity.

* Cellular Stress Response: MOTS-c appears to enhance cellular resilience. It plays a role in protecting against metabolic disturbances and may help cells adapt to stressful conditions by modulating pathways like AMPK/PGC-1α, which are critical for energy sensing and mitochondrial biogenesis.

* Muscle Function and Mass: Research indicates that MOTS-c can modulate skeletal muscle functionMOTS-c, the Most Recent Mitochondrial Derived Peptide in .... It has been shown to directly bind to and regulate the activity of certain enzymes, like CK2, which in turn influences glucose metabolism and muscle mass. It also plays a role in reducing myostatin signaling, a factor that can limit muscle growth.

Important Considerations and Future Directions

While the initial findings regarding MOTS-c are promising, it's crucial to approach its application with a scientific perspective. Much of the current understanding comes from animal studies, and human trials are essential to confirm its safety and efficacy. Athletes and individuals considering using MOTS-c should be aware of the evolving research landscape and potential regulatory considerations, as substances like peptides can be subject to strict guidelines in competitive sports.

The unique mitochondrial origin of MOTS-c offers a novel perspective on peptide biology and its role in health and aging.
